How to set up your Run Rate Report widget:

  1. By default, you will already have a blank Run Rate Report widget on your default dashboard. You can always add additional reports by clicking on the 'Customise your Dashboard' button positioned in the top right-hand corner of your screen and select "Run Rate Widget" from the dropdown list that appears.

  2. Configure Run Rate Report: A blank Run Rate Report will appear on your dashboard ready to be configured. You will need to use the 4 filter bars at the top of the widget to create your report:

    a. Select the Record type you'd like to report on

    ​b. Select the Statuses you wish to include in your analysis

    c. Set your desired date range for review

    d. (optional) Filter your report further by filtering by specific fields such as floors, QA results, trade specific tasks and more, providing a more targeted view within the Run Rate widget.

    e. If only one status has been selected, you'll be able to select a target date. This addition generates an average line, offering insight into your progress toward your target

    ​​

  3. View Your Run Rate Report: Once created, the report will appear on your dashboard, providing you with a concise overview of relevant metrics and statistics.

  4. Reposition Widgets: To organise your dashboard, you can always move your widgets around by simply clicking and dragging them to your preferred location.

Can I set up a Run Rate Report for tasks?

Yes, any record type can be configured for your Run Rate Reports.

Can I rename my Run Rate Report?

Yes, you can rename your reports and any widget on your dashboard by simply double clicking on the current report name.

Can I select a target date with multiple statuses?

You can only set a target date for one status at a time. This is to keep things clear and straightforward for you when you're tracking your project's progress and deadlines. But don't worry—if you need to keep tabs on multiple target dates for different statuses, you can easily add more run rate charts to your dashboard.

Can I create more than one Run Rate Report widget?

Yes, you can create and add as many run rate reports and widgets to your dashboard. Your dashboard is fully customisable so you can add and move around widgets that best suit your needs.

Can I select multiple statuses in one report?

Absolutely! you can select multiple statuses within a single report. As a result, the report will show each status represented by a distinct coloured line. Selecting multiple statuses provides a more comprehensive overview of various statuses within a single view, putting all your status updates in one place for a better picture.
